作者简介


戴尔·卡耐基,美国“成人教育之父”。20世纪早期,美国经济陷入萧条,战争和贫困导致人们失去了对美好生活的愿望,而卡耐基独辟蹊径地开创了一套融演讲、推销、为人处世、智能开发于一体的教育方式,他运用社会学和心理学知识,对人性进行了深刻的探讨和分析。他讲述的许多普通人通过奋斗获得成功的真实故事,激励了无数陷入迷茫和困境的人,帮助他们重新找到了自己的人生。

接受卡耐基教育的有社会各界人士,其中不乏军政要员,甚至包括几位美国总统。千千万万的人从卡耐基的教育中获益匪浅。

卡耐基在实践的基础上撰写而成的著作,是20世纪最畅销的成功励志经典。他的主要代表作有《人性的弱点》、《人性的优点》、《语言的突破》、《人性的弱点全集》。这些书出版后,立即风靡全世界,先后被翻译成几十种文字,被誉为“人类出版史上的奇迹”,无数读者由此走上了成功之路。
